Mariia Kravchenko is a scholar working on Strategy and Management, Marketing and Environmental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Mariia Kravchenko has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 591 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Strategy and Management, 7 papers in Marketing and 4 papers in Environmental Engineering. Recurrent topics in Mariia Kravchenko's work include Sustainable Supply Chain Management (12 papers), Environmental Sustainability in Business (6 papers) and Environmental Impact and Sustainability (4 papers). Mariia Kravchenko is often cited by papers focused on Sustainable Supply Chain Management (12 papers), Environmental Sustainability in Business (6 papers) and Environmental Impact and Sustainability (4 papers). Mariia Kravchenko collaborates with scholars based in Denmark, United States and France. Mariia Kravchenko's co-authors include Daniela C. A. Pigosso, Tim C. McAloone, Eivind Kristoffersen, Sasha Shahbazi, Marina Pieroni, Fenna Blomsma, Jingyue Li, Jutta Hildenbrand, Michael Saidani and Harrison Kim and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Cleaner Production, Sustainability and Occupational Safety in Industry.
